What are the responsibilities and job description for the Bio Building Attendant position at Daybreak Foods, Inc.?
JOB REQUIREMENTS: Description Summary The Bio Building Attendant is
responsible for shuttling all stakeholders/crews around the facility
while complying with and enforcing bio-security procedures, cleaning all
areas of bio-building and laundering uniforms. Key Responsibilities
Ensure the security of chickens and the premises by keeping all facility
doors locked to protect birds from predators, external climate and
unauthorized personnel Document completed tasks on a daily and weekly
basis Sweep and clean different areas of the buildings and hallways
Janitorial duties of cleaning break room, restrooms, truck wash area,
offices, etc.. Responsible for sorting, washing and drying of uniforms
and footwear Distribute safety supplies Request needed safety supplies,
material, parts, etc. to designated department procurement stakeholder
Perform pre-operation inspection on all vehicles and equipment Transport
stakeholders/crews around different locations on the facility if needed
Maintain site shuttle Implement bio-security procedures for all
employees, visitors, vendors and contractors entering site Perform other
